Transaction 191e1a6412ebea21e4d1c13e4ab8e8881a6eceb66979445e437e0313fdc906e6

2 Input
2 Outputs
  • 191e1a6412ebea21e4d1c13e4ab8e8881a6eceb66979445e437e0313fdc906e6:0
  • value  43348620
    address  1CMhqbXJnAZAoh1deufMbNjFedW3TrchXA
  • 191e1a6412ebea21e4d1c13e4ab8e8881a6eceb66979445e437e0313fdc906e6:1
  • value  104155800
    address  1L2gTtXy5BXdeafKQf3s989vHzRLxCBKrP